The advertisement in the photograph was recently placed by Lamar
Advertising of Montgomery, AL (http://www.lamar.com)
on I-85 North near the Alabama State University campus; a predominant black
school. This add is for the white supremacist group; League of the South (https://www.facebook.com/leagueofthesouth).
The League of the South is listed on the SPLC Web Page as a hate group (http://www.splcenter.org/get-informed/intelligence-files/groups/league-of-the-south)
and has the following as their doctrine:
Michael Hill, the group’s president,
wrote an essay two years ago that says: -
“White people are “endowed with a God ordained superiority.”
Freeing the slaves was “a disaster for whites and blacks alike.
Black people “have never created anything approximating a civilization.”
It’s a “monumental lie” that all men are created equal.
He’s a man who believes slavery is biblically ordained, and that the Southern
states should be a separate country ruled by white people”.
